Agriculture Department Begins Study to Set Support Price for Chaitra Paddy
Summary
The Department of Agriculture has begun a study across 25 districts to determine a fair support price for Chaitra paddy, considering production costs and market prices.
Key Points
- The Department of Agriculture has started a study to set the support price for Chaitra paddy.
- The study covers 25 districts and considers costs such as seeds, fertilizer, labor, inflation, and market prices.
- Director General Prakash Sanjel stated that the proposed price will be recommended to the Ministry of Agriculture and Livestock Development.
- The price will be finalized by the Council of Ministers and implemented through the Food Management and Trading Company Limited.
